Hit this at http://logs.openstack.org/41/116741/4/check/check-tempest-dsvm-full/e165c84/, found in the glance-api logs:
2014-08-27 04:13:14.268 22185 INFO glance.wsgi.server [-] 127.0.0.1 - - [27/Aug/2014 04:13:14] "HEAD /v1/images/36d64eb9-8f79-4ef9-9dfc-30c7c0be2651 HTTP/1.1" 200 932 0.039862 2014-08-27 04:13:14.393 22185 DEBUG glance.registry.client.v1.client [-] Registry request PUT /images/c42364fe-3420-4532-83b4-3340e51acd67 HTTP 200 request id req-307dd390-a384-4bc4-98ff-e631e3dd7083 do_request /opt/stack/new/glance/glance/registry/client/v1/client.py:122 2014-08-27 04:13:14.394 22185 ERROR glance.api.v1.images [-] Copy from external source 'swift' failed for image: c42364fe-3420-4532-83b4-3340e51acd67 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images Traceback (most recent call last): 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images File "/opt/stack/new/glance/glance/api/v1/images.py", line 583, in _upload 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images dest=store) 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images File "/opt/stack/new/glance/glance/api/v1/images.py", line 453, in _get_from_store 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images context, where, dest=dest) 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images File "/opt/stack/new/glance/glance/store/__init__.py", line 266, in get_from_backend 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images return src_store.get(loc) 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images File "/opt/stack/new/glance/glance/store/http.py", line 123, in get 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images conn, resp, content_length = self._query(location, 'GET') 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images File "/opt/stack/new/glance/glance/store/http.py", line 179, in _query 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images raise exception.BadStoreUri(message=reason) 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images BadStoreUri: HTTP URL returned a 500 status code. 2014-08-27 04:13:14.394 22185 TRACE glance.api.v1.images 2014-08-27 04:13:14.791 22185 DEBUG glance.registry.client.v1.api [-] Adding image metadata... add_image_metadata /opt/stack/new/glance/glance/registry/client/v1/api.py:159 2014-08-27 04:13:14.792 22185 DEBUG glance.common.client [-] Constructed URL: http://0.0.0.0:9191/images _construct_url /opt/stack/new/glance/glance/common/client.py:413
Hit this at http:// logs.openstack. org/41/ 116741/ 4/check/ check-tempest- dsvm-full/ e165c84/, found in the glance-api logs:
2014-08-27 04:13:14.268 22185 INFO glance.wsgi.server [-] 127.0.0.1 - - [27/Aug/2014 04:13:14] "HEAD /v1/images/ 36d64eb9- 8f79-4ef9- 9dfc-30c7c0be26 51 HTTP/1.1" 200 932 0.039862 registry. client. v1.client [-] Registry request PUT /images/ c42364fe- 3420-4532- 83b4-3340e51acd 67 HTTP 200 request id req-307dd390- a384-4bc4- 98ff-e631e3dd70 83 do_request /opt/stack/ new/glance/ glance/ registry/ client/ v1/client. py:122 api.v1. images [-] Copy from external source 'swift' failed for image: c42364fe- 3420-4532- 83b4-3340e51acd 67 api.v1. images Traceback (most recent call last): api.v1. images File "/opt/stack/ new/glance/ glance/ api/v1/ images. py", line 583, in _upload api.v1. images dest=store) api.v1. images File "/opt/stack/ new/glance/ glance/ api/v1/ images. py", line 453, in _get_from_store api.v1. images context, where, dest=dest) api.v1. images File "/opt/stack/ new/glance/ glance/ store/_ _init__ .py", line 266, in get_from_backend api.v1. images return src_store.get(loc) api.v1. images File "/opt/stack/ new/glance/ glance/ store/http. py", line 123, in get api.v1. images conn, resp, content_length = self._query( location, 'GET') api.v1. images File "/opt/stack/ new/glance/ glance/ store/http. py", line 179, in _query api.v1. images raise exception. BadStoreUri( message= reason) api.v1. images BadStoreUri: HTTP URL returned a 500 status code. api.v1. images registry. client. v1.api [-] Adding image metadata... add_image_metadata /opt/stack/ new/glance/ glance/ registry/ client/ v1/api. py:159 common. client [-] Constructed URL: http:// 0.0.0.0: 9191/images _construct_url /opt/stack/ new/glance/ glance/ common/ client. py:413
2014-08-27 04:13:14.393 22185 DEBUG glance.
2014-08-27 04:13:14.394 22185 ERROR gl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.394 22185 TRACE glance.
2014-08-27 04:13:14.791 22185 DEBUG glance.
2014-08-27 04:13:14.792 22185 DEBUG glance.